Where does “juovanaamamarakatti” come from?

juovanaamamarakatti (Finnish) comes from Finnish juova, from Finnish juoda, from Proto-Finnic joodak, from Proto-Uralic jëxe- — to drink; to flow?.

juovanaamamarakatti (Finnish): owl-faced monkey, Hamlyn's monkey, Cercopithecus hamlyni
